target-ppc: Fix type casts for w64 (uintptr_t) This changes nothing for other hosts. Signed-off-by: Stefan Weil <sw@weilnetz.de> Signed-off-by: Andreas Färber <afaerber@suse.de>
diff --git a/target-ppc/translate_init.c b/target-ppc/translate_init.c index 025122d..fdc0a5f 100644 --- a/target-ppc/translate_init.c +++ b/target-ppc/translate_init.c
@@ -9504,12 +9504,12 @@ static inline int is_indirect_opcode (void *handler) { - return ((unsigned long)handler & 0x03) == PPC_INDIRECT; + return ((uintptr_t)handler & 0x03) == PPC_INDIRECT; } static inline opc_handler_t **ind_table(void *handler) { - return (opc_handler_t **)((unsigned long)handler & ~3); + return (opc_handler_t **)((uintptr_t)handler & ~3); } /* Instruction table creation */ @@ -9528,7 +9528,7 @@ tmp = malloc(0x20 * sizeof(opc_handler_t)); fill_new_table(tmp, 0x20); - table[idx] = (opc_handler_t *)((unsigned long)tmp | PPC_INDIRECT); + table[idx] = (opc_handler_t *)((uintptr_t)tmp | PPC_INDIRECT); return 0; }
